Employment Outlook There are jobs available for this occupation. This job is influenced by the amount of crime done in the area. This job will grow at a rate of about 17% from now to 2018.

Advancement Opportunities You can advance in rank. Chief of police is the highest rank. You still have to continue training after you graduate.
